River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 65
- Land Area (2000): 30.449 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 0.000 square kilometers
Houses (2000): 28
River Population - Urban/Rural
Urban/Rural | Population | Percent |
---|---|---|
Urban | 0 | 0.00% |
Rural, Farm | 16 | 19.75% |
Rural, Non-farm | 65 | 80.25% |
